Exploring the Medieval Old Town of Rouen
One of the highlights of the Normandy tour is exploring the Medieval Old Town of Rouen.
Travelers wander Rouen’s cobblestone streets, admiring its half-timbered houses and Gothic architecture. They visit the impressive Rouen Cathedral, a masterpiece of French Gothic style. The guide shares the history of Joan of Arc, who was tried and executed here.
Travelers enjoy the lively market square and quaint cafes. They explore the narrow alleys, discovering hidden courtyards and local shops.
The Medieval Old Town provides a glimpse into Normandy’s storied past, enchanting visitors with its timeless charm.
Discovering the Stunning Cliffs of Étretat
After exploring the medieval charms of Rouen, the tour takes visitors to the stunning cliffs of Étretat. Rising dramatically from the sea, these white chalk cliffs are a natural wonder.
Visitors can walk along the clifftops, taking in the breathtaking views of the English Channel. The famous Aval cliff, with its naturally formed archway, is a highlight.
Étretat’s charming seaside town offers opportunities to explore quaint shops and cafes. The tour allows time to soak in the tranquil seaside atmosphere and capture unforgettable photos of the iconic cliffs.
